About Barrya Village

Barrya is a small village in Raghogarh tehsil, in the district of Guna, Madhya Pradesh. The Census of India 2011 recorded a population of 496, made up of 269 males and 227 females. That works out to a sex ratio of about 844 females per 1000 males. The village covers 236 hectares hectares.

Getting to Barrya

The census records public bus service for Barrya as Available within <5 km distance. Private bus service is recorded as Available within <5 km distance. For rail, the census notes the nearest railway station as Available within 10+ km distance. These entries describe what was recorded in 2011 and services may have changed since.
